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2494821576 24749980 003 303909 16
5415093628 86 39716407636
5415093628 86 39716407636
830 65086964 847828255 55633
All about undefined
Interested in learning more?
5415093628 86 39716407636
830 65086964 847828255 55633
See more
1811597007 930771716 811024
12393273365 18 2695
See more
35410102 69712
09911534 00174674238 18 61 72
See more